Understanding PoE+
Before we explore the compatibility, let's first understand what PoE+ is. Power over Ethernet (PoE) is a technology that allows electrical power to be transmitted along with data over Ethernet cables. PoE+ is an enhanced version of PoE, defined by the IEEE 802.3at standard. It can deliver up to 30 watts of power to connected devices, which is more than the standard PoE (IEEE 802.3af) that can supply up to 15.4 watts. PoE+ is widely used in applications such as IP cameras, wireless access points, and VoIP phones, providing a convenient way to power these devices without the need for separate power cables.
CAT7 Patch Cords: Features and Specifications
CAT7 patch cords are designed to support high - speed data transmission in Ethernet networks. They are part of the Category 7 cabling standard, which offers superior performance compared to its predecessors like the Category 5E Patch Cord and CAT6A UTP FTP Patch Cord.
The main features of CAT7 patch cords include:


- High - frequency performance: CAT7 cables are capable of operating at frequencies up to 600 MHz, which enables them to support data transfer rates of up to 10 Gigabits per second (Gbps) over distances of up to 100 meters.
- Shielding: CAT7 patch cords typically have individual shielding for each pair of wires and an overall shield. This shielding helps to reduce electromagnetic interference (EMI) and crosstalk, ensuring reliable data transmission even in environments with high levels of electrical noise.
- Durability: The construction of CAT7 patch cords is more robust compared to lower - category cables. They are often made with high - quality materials that can withstand bending, pulling, and other physical stresses, making them suitable for long - term use in demanding network environments.
Compatibility of CAT7 Patch Cords with PoE+
Now, let's address the core question: Do CAT7 patch cords support PoE+? The answer is yes. CAT7 patch cords are fully compatible with PoE+ technology.
The reason lies in the electrical characteristics of the cables. PoE+ operates on the same pairs of wires (usually pairs 1 - 2 and 3 - 6) as traditional Ethernet data transmission. CAT7 patch cords, like other Ethernet cables, have these pairs available for both data and power transmission.
The high - quality conductors used in CAT7 patch cords can handle the electrical current required for PoE+ without significant power loss. The shielding in CAT7 cables also helps to maintain the integrity of the power signal, reducing the risk of interference that could affect the performance of PoE+ devices.
In addition, the CAT7 standard does not impose any restrictions on the use of PoE or PoE+. As long as the network infrastructure, including the PoE+ switch and the connected device, is properly configured, CAT7 patch cords can be used to deliver both data and power simultaneously.

Considerations for Using CAT7 Patch Cords with PoE+
While CAT7 patch cords are compatible with PoE+, there are a few considerations to keep in mind when using them in PoE+ applications:
- Cable length: Although CAT7 patch cords can support PoE+ over distances of up to 100 meters, it's important to note that the power delivery may be affected by cable length. Longer cables may experience more power loss, which could result in reduced power available at the connected device. It's recommended to keep the cable length as short as possible, especially for devices that require the full 30 watts of PoE+ power.
- Heat dissipation: PoE+ involves the transmission of electrical power, which generates heat in the cables. The shielding in CAT7 patch cords can help to contain the heat, but it's still important to ensure proper ventilation in the network environment to prevent overheating. Overheating can not only damage the cables but also affect the performance of the PoE+ devices.
- Installation: Proper installation of CAT7 patch cords is crucial for both data and power transmission. The cables should be installed according to the manufacturer's guidelines, including proper termination and grounding. Incorrect installation can lead to signal degradation, power loss, and other issues that could affect the performance of the PoE+ system.
